In which of the following there is intermolecular hydrogen bonding ?

A

Water

B

Ethanol

C

Acetic acid

D

H-F

To determine which of the given compounds exhibits intermolecular hydrogen bonding, we need to understand what intermolecular hydrogen bonding is and identify the presence of hydrogen atoms bonded to highly electronegative atoms (such as nitrogen, oxygen, or fluorine) in the compounds provided.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Intermolecular Hydrogen Bonding**: - Intermolecular hydrogen bonding occurs between different molecules. It involves a hydrogen atom that is covalently bonded to a highly electronegative atom (like N, O, or F) and is attracted to another electronegative atom in a neighboring molecule. 2. **Analyzing Each Compound**: - **Water (H2O)**: - Each water molecule has two hydrogen atoms bonded to one oxygen atom. The oxygen atom can form hydrogen bonds with the hydrogen atoms of neighboring water molecules. - **Conclusion**: Water exhibits int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Ethanol (C2H5OH)**: - Ethanol has an -OH (hydroxyl) group. The hydrogen in the hydroxyl group can form hydrogen bonds with the oxygen of another ethanol molecule. - **Conclusion**: Ethanol exhibits int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Acetic Acid (CH3COOH)**: - Acetic acid contains a hydroxyl group (-OH) and can form hydrogen bonds between the hydrogen of one acetic acid molecule and the oxygen of another. - **Conclusion**: Acetic acid exhibits int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Hydrogen Fluoride (HF)**: - HF has a hydrogen atom bonded to fluorine, which is highly electronegative. HF molecules can form hydrogen bonds with each other. - **Conclusion**: Hydrogen fluoride exhibits intermolecular hydrogen bonding. 3. **Final Conclusion**: - All the compounds listed (water, ethanol, acetic acid, and hydrogen fluoride) exhibit intermolecular hydrogen bonding. ### Summary of Findings: - **Water (H2O)**: Yes, int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Ethanol (C2H5OH)**: Yes, int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Acetic Acid (CH3COOH)**: Yes, intermolecular hydrogen bonding. - **Hydrogen Fluoride (HF)**: Yes, intermolecular hydrogen bonding.
